Olivier Certner

Olivier has been continuously using FreeBSD on all his machines and those of some of the companies he worked with since the end of 2004. During this time, he has grown a set of private customizations including modifications to rc scripts and some kernel bits. After having worked for over 15 years in the CAD and finance sectors, he lately switched back to pure IT topics, and in particular operating system development. His main interests are centered around kernel development, with particular focuses on power management, security, scheduling, file systems and jails. He's currently a contractor for the FreeBSD Foundation.

Supporting hibernate (S4) on FreeBSD
Olivier Certner

In this talk, we describe our current work in progress on supporting hibernate on FreeBSD. First, we outline the different high-level steps that are necessary. Then, we delve into how we actually implement them, including ACPI interfacing and programming, how we take a snapshot of kernel memory, save the image to disk and restore it on boot. Finally, we report on this development's status.
